A funky and welcoming bar and restaurant space, upstairs above the Kingscliff Beach Hotel.
An extensive drinks menu, fantastic Allpress coffee and a really inventive and modern dining menu. Their share plates are a great way to dine, tapas style or there's also a full mains menu on offer with delicious desserts (including a divine Banoffie Pie).
Hip and quirky decor, this place was inspired by Babalou, a surfing dog in Biarritz, South West France. There's even a vinyls lounge library, with an old school record player and collection for you to sit back and enjoy.
Open for breakfast and brunch, lunch, sunset cocktails and dinner - and they even do high teas. Perfect on a summer's day with wide open verandah style windows overlooking the ocean.
Sunday afternoon DJ sessions provide the perfect opportunity to sit back and chill, as you gaze across the sea to Cook Island.
